Fast, Reliable Gate Parts & Welding Across Burien

Gate hardware fails faster in Burien than almost anywhere else in King County. Salt-laden marine air off Puget Sound eats through hinges, latches, and steel frames years before the same parts give out in Renton or Kent, and the clay soil under Burien’s hillside lots keeps pulling gate posts out of plumb with every wet/dry cycle. That combination means most gate repairs here need two things done at once: corrosion remediation and post re-setting. Our Gate Parts & Welding team handles both on the same visit. Our Gate Parts & Welding Services in Burien

Hinge Replacement

In Burien, hinge replacement rarely means just swapping out a pair of hinges. The salt air off Puget Sound corrodes ferrous hinge pins until they seize, then snap under the weight of a swinging panel. And on sloped lots, the post itself has usually tipped downhill, which is what stressed those hinges in the first place. We re-set the post, then install galvanized or stainless hardware rated for marine exposure. The hinges and the post have to work together; fix one without the other and you’ll be back in the same spot next winter.

Hinge Replacement

Post Replacement

Burien’s clay-dominant soil is the real story here. The heavy seasonal rains saturate the ground, the clay expands, and when it dries it contracts. That cycle slowly walks gate posts out of vertical, especially on hillside streets where gravity pulls everything toward the Sound. We dig out the old footing, set the new post deeper with proper concrete, and use stainless fixings so the new post isn’t fighting the same corrosion battle. A post replacement in Burien usually means going deeper than the original 1960s footer, because those old footings were sized for different soil assumptions.

Post Replacement

Rail Repair

Wood-framed gates from Burien’s Boeing-era housing boom are now 50 to 70 years old. The rails are often rotted at the post base, especially where wet leaves and marine moisture collect against the hardware. We cut out the rot, weld or bolt in replacement steel or treated rails as needed, and ensure the frame integrity matches the operator’s torque load. If you have our Gate Motor & Opener in Burien on an older wood gate, the rail repair has to account for what the motor is asking of the frame.

Rail Repair

Custom Welding

Sometimes the right fix is not a replacement part; it’s a welded repair on the steel that’s already there. A cracked frame on a 1960s steel gate near Burien’s waterfront doesn’t need to be scrapped. We weld on site, in your driveway, with the gate still on its hinges. That matters on sloped lots where removing the gate means dealing with a heavy panel on uneven ground. We can fabricate hinge plates, weld gussets into stress points, and reinforce sections that have rusted thin. If the post base is also compromised, we handle that in the same visit.

Common Gate Parts & Welding Problems We See in Burien Homes

  • Seized hinge pins from salt-air rust. The combined effect of Puget Sound moisture and constant dampness means hinges that would stay functional inland for decades get stiff here in three to five years. Once they seize, the gate starts binding, the operator strains, and the pin eventually snaps under load.
  • Posts tilting downhill on sloped lots. Clay soil heave is relentless. Homes on the hillside streets stepping down toward Three Tree Point see posts migrate toward the Sound a little more each wet/dry cycle. That tips the gate out of alignment, throws off the latch, and puts uneven stress on hinges and operator gears.
  • Rotted wood frames at the post base. Those mid-century ranch homes in Burien often still have their original wood gate frames. Near-constant dampness plus poor drainage at the footing means the wood rots from the bottom up, while the steel hardware above is simultaneously rusting through. By the time a homeowner notices, the damage is usually structural.
  • Corroded operator mounting brackets and safety edges. The operator itself may run fine, but the steel bracket holding it to the post has rusted thin, or the safety edge strip has degraded from constant moisture. In Burien, a gate that “just stopped working” often turns out to be a failed bracket or a corroded limit switch housing, not a dead motor.

Pricing for Gate Parts & Welding in Burien, WA

You should know what to expect before anyone touches your gate, and the price gets quoted and agreed before any work starts. Here’s what Burien homeowners typically see:

  • Hinge replacement: $280-$540 for a standard two-hinge swing gate, depending on hinge size and whether stainless hardware replaces the old galvanized set.
  • Post replacement: $450-$900, which includes digging out the old footing, setting the new post deeper, concrete, and stainless fixings. Sloped lots run toward the higher end because the footing has to resist downhill migration.
  • Rail repair: $180-$420 for cutting out rot and welding or bolting in replacement steel rails on an average mid-century gate frame.
  • Custom welding: $150-$700 depending on the scope. A simple hinge plate weld runs on the low end; reinforcing a cracked steel frame near the post base runs higher.
